If you want to lose weight (fat) quickly, try a PSMF (protein sparing modified fast) as a jumpstart into a maintenance diet / lifestyle change. Just make sure you're getting enough protein to avoid losing too much lean mass.
Look for the book (ebook/pdf) by Lyle McDonald "The Rapid Fat Loss Handbook" for more details.
Yes, it is a crash diet. You have to have the discipline to move into the proper maintenance routine after you've completed it or else you'll just gain it all back.

i am actually working up to that! here is the ultimate 300 workout i am shooting for
Pullups - 25 reps
Barbell Deadlift with 135 lbs. - 50 reps
Pushups - 50 reps
24-inch Box Jumps - 50 reps
Floor Wipers - 50 reps
Single-Arm Clean-and-Press with 36 lbs Kettlebell - 50 reps
Pullups - 25 reps
